Transaction 01c77ffe2881c66ce78043b3a2f3414c3280102ca909f390875bcbf165d2e4c8

2 Input
2 Outputs
  • 01c77ffe2881c66ce78043b3a2f3414c3280102ca909f390875bcbf165d2e4c8:0
  • value  157265
    address  125e4jwGDa7sJmSsaFejBep3h16p58sMgA
  • 01c77ffe2881c66ce78043b3a2f3414c3280102ca909f390875bcbf165d2e4c8:1
  • value  25806929
    address  3QbSQLz7gXm2UcY7573kdLdtNPb3PXct3m